WebAug 24, 2024 · Measure 1 to 2 tablespoons of dried herbs into the bottom of a mortar. Place the pestle in the bowl and begin grinding. Firmly press the pestle into the bottom and sides of the bowl to crush the herbs. Continue crushing until you have a fine, even powder. Place the powdered herbs in a separate container and label accordingly. WebAug 21, 2024 · The drying process changes the flavor of your herbs. Most of the time, the flavor becomes more intense, so you can use a smaller amount of dried herbs compared to fresh. Rosemary, thyme, and bay leaves are all examples of this pattern. Indeed, all the dried herbs you find sold at a grocery store are packed with flavor. WebOct 27, 2024 · 3. Flavor: Dried herbs will emit a stronger flavor so long as you cook them. Heat releases the oils in them to produce a more flavorful taste. If you won’t be cooking …
